Classer par ordre croissant avec critère texte situés dans 2 colonnes en VBA

Fermé
rorocr Messages postés 81 Date d'inscription mardi 8 septembre 2015 Statut Membre Dernière intervention 8 juin 2022 - 10 juin 2020 à 10:52
yg_be Messages postés 23402 Date d'inscription lundi 9 juin 2008 Statut Contributeur Dernière intervention 20 décembre 2024 - 16 juin 2020 à 22:03
Bonjour le Forum,


J'ai besoin de créer une fonction en VBA qui me permettrait de classer des dates par rapport à un critère texte.
Là ou ça se complique, c'est que le texte est associé forcément à une date mais cela peu être dans 2 tableaux différents.


Je joint un exemple pour détailler mon problème.

https://cjoint.com/c/JFki0lVqHZw


Merci d'avance

Cordialement
A voir également:

21 réponses

rorocr Messages postés 81 Date d'inscription mardi 8 septembre 2015 Statut Membre Dernière intervention 8 juin 2022 1
16 juin 2020 à 21:06
Bonsoir,

Pour le reste des opérations à suivre, elles ne sont pas toutes encore connues mais elles dépendent du classement que je cherche à faire. Ce ne sont pas des choses compliquées que je pourrais gérer seul juste avec des fonctions simples.
Je ne comprends pas pourquoi créer une formule semble hors de question dans ce contexte car pour moi au contraire c'est la meilleure solution car une fois mon tableau de classement créé avec cette fameuse formule, je pourrais m'adapter en fonction de ce que je rechercherais alors qu'avec une macro, si j'avais une modification je serais dans l'impasse complète car je n'y connais absolument rien contrairement aux fonctions que je connais bien mieux car j'en utilise tous les jours.

Je vous remets ci dessous un lien avec des explications plus détaillées car mes besoins ont quelques peu changés depuis la création du sujet.

https://www.cjoint.com/c/JFqnvMaoW4G

Pensez-vous pouvoir trouver une solution en créant une fonction qui permettrait une recherche dans plusieurs plages avant de classer par ordre croissant les dates associées?


Bien cordialement,
0
yg_be Messages postés 23402 Date d'inscription lundi 9 juin 2008 Statut Contributeur Dernière intervention 20 décembre 2024 1 557
16 juin 2020 à 22:03
je suis content que ta très bonne connaissance des formules te permette de résoudre ton problème.
moi, je ne vois pas comment résoudre cela avec une formule.
je respecte donc ton jugement à propos de l'utilisation d'une formule, et je te laisse y travailler.
bonne continuation.
0